Certified Professional in Green Space Accessibility is a comprehensive program designed to equip individuals with the knowledge and skills needed to ensure outdoor spaces are inclusive and accessible to all.
Participants will learn how to assess, design, and manage green spaces in a way that promotes accessibility for individuals with disabilities and diverse needs.
The learning outcomes of this certification include mastering key concepts related to universal design, understanding relevant legislation and guidelines, and developing practical skills for implementing accessibility features in green spaces.
Upon completion of the program, participants will be able to create welcoming and inclusive outdoor environments that cater to a wide range of users.
This certification program typically spans over 6 weeks and is self-paced, allowing participants to study at their own convenience.
Through a combination of online lectures, case studies, and practical assignments, individuals can gain a deep understanding of green space accessibility principles and best practices.
